There was 5 exabytes of information created between the dawn of civilization through 2003,” [Google CEO Eric] Schmidt said, “but that much information is now created every 2 days, and the pace is increasing…People aren’t ready for the technology revolution that’s going to happen to them.

Google, Privacy and the New Explosion of Data - Techonomy (via davemorin) (via juliaallison)

[Jim’s Note: 1 exabyte=1 billion gigabytes]
